Description
|
To act as a forum for the presentation of innovative new media content, professional and creative practice in Ireland.To present case-study lectures / workshops by leading practitioners from a range of multimedia specialisms.To develop knowledge of content creation and development for specific target audiences.

| Workload |
Full-time hours per semester |
| Type |
Hours |
Description |
| Lecture | 24 | Presentations on diverse applications and potential in digital industries | | On-line learning | 24 | Research of areas related to presentations | | Directed learning | 12 | Attendance at cultural events to include theatre, film, performance, trade-fairs | | Independent learning time | 65 | Research relating to wider project development | | Total Workload: 125 |

| Assessment Breakdown | | Continuous Assessment | 100% | Examination Weight | 0% |
| Course Work Breakdown |
| Type | Description | % of total | Assessment Date |
| Reflective journal | a week-by-week account indicating intellectual progress; critical responses to wider digital cultural environment; applications and links between presentations, topics and projects | 100% | Week 12 |
| Reassessment Requirement |
Resit arrangements are explained by the following categories;
1 = A resit is available for all components of the module
2 = No resit is available for 100% continuous assessment module
3 = No resit is available for the continuous assessment component |
| This module is category 1 |
